多版本如何使用git
-
多版本如何使用git
Git是一款开源的分布式版本控制系统,它可以帮助我们管理和追踪代码的变更,同时也支持多版本的管理。在使用Git时,我们可以通过以下几种方式来实现多版本的管理:
1. 分支管理:Git的分支机制允许我们在同一个代码仓库中同时创建多个分支,每个分支都可以代表一个不同的代码版本。我们可以在不影响主分支的情况下,在其他分支上进行代码的修改和提交。通过切换不同的分支,我们可以快速切换到不同的代码版本。
在Git中,创建分支可以使用以下命令:
“`
git branch# 创建一个名为 的分支
“`切换分支可以使用以下命令:
“`
git checkout# 切换到名为 的分支
“`2. 标签管理:标签是一个具体的代码版本的快照,它是一个不可变的引用,常用于对代码进行版本号的标记。我们可以使用标签来记录代码的重要版本,并可以随时切换到指定的标签版本。
在Git中,创建标签可以使用以下命令:
“`
git tag# 创建一个名为 的标签
“`切换到标签版本可以使用以下命令:
“`
git checkout# 切换到名为 的标签版本
“`3. 变基(rebase)操作:变基操作允许将当前分支的提交应用到另一个基准分支上,可以用于合并分支或者改写提交历史。通过变基操作,我们可以将多个分支的修改整合到一个分支中,以实现多版本的管理。
在Git中,执行变基操作可以使用以下命令:
“`
git rebase# 将当前分支的提交应用到 分支上
“`总结:
通过分支管理、标签管理和变基操作,我们可以很容易地实现多版本的管理。使用Git来管理代码的不同版本,可以帮助我们更好地追踪和管理代码的变更,提高代码的可维护性和团队协作效率。2年前 -
使用Git的多版本管理功能,可以让用户在一个代码库中同时管理多个版本。这对于软件开发团队来说非常有用,可以在不同的版本中进行并行开发和维护。下面将介绍如何在Git中使用多版本。
1. 创建新的分支:在Git中,分支是独立的版本线,可以在不影响主分支的情况下进行修改和提交。可以使用以下命令创建新的分支:
“`
git branch
“`
其中``为新分支的名称。 2. 切换分支:可以使用以下命令切换到已存在的分支:
“`
git checkout
“`
其中``为切换的分支名称。 3. 合并分支:当在一个分支中的开发工作完成后,可以将其合并到主分支或其他分支中。可以使用以下命令进行合并:
“`
git merge
“`
其中``为要合并的分支的名称。 4. 比较版本差异:使用Git可以轻松地比较不同分支或版本之间的差异。可以使用以下命令来比较:
“`
git diff
“`
其中``和` `为要比较的分支或版本的名称。 5. 标签版本:在Git中,可以给某个版本打上标签,以便快速找到该版本。可以使用以下命令来创建标签:
“`
git tag
“`
其中``为标签名称,` `为要打标签的版本的提交ID。 6. 切换到标签版本:可以使用以下命令将代码切换到标签所代表的版本:
“`
git checkout
“`
其中``为要切换到标签所代表的版本的名称。 总结:
使用Git的多版本管理功能,可以通过创建和切换分支来管理多个版本,合并分支来将开发工作的变更合并到主分支或其他分支中。可以使用比较命令来比较不同分支或版本之间的差异,并给某个版本添加标签以方便查找。此外,还可以使用标签版本切换命令将代码切换到标签所代表的版本。这些功能使得团队可以更灵活地进行并行开发和维护多个版本的代码。
2年前 -
使用Git进行多版本管理可以通过以下几个步骤完成:
1. 初始化仓库:
在要进行多版本管理的项目目录中,打开终端并输入以下命令来初始化一个新的Git仓库:
“`shell
$ git init
“`2. 创建分支:
分支是Git中非常重要的概念,它可以用来在同时进行多个开发任务或实验性的改动。要创建一个新的分支,可以使用以下命令:
“`shell
$ git branch
“`其中,`
`是你希望创建的分支名称。 3. 切换分支:
创建分支后,要切换到该分支,可以使用以下命令:
“`shell
$ git checkout
“`4. 添加修改:
在切换到正确的分支后,可以对项目进行修改,并使用以下命令将修改添加到暂存区中:
“`shell
$ git add
“`其中,`
`是你希望添加的文件名。如果要添加所有修改的文件,可以使用以下命令: “`shell
$ git add .
“`5. 提交修改:
将暂存区中的修改提交到当前分支的版本历史记录中,可以使用以下命令:
“`shell
$ git commit -m “”
“`其中,`
`是对本次提交的描述。 6. 合并分支:
当一个分支的工作完成后,可以将其合并到主分支或其他分支中。首先,切换到目标分支,然后执行以下命令来进行分支合并:
“`shell
$ git merge
“`其中,`
`是要合并的分支的名称。 7. 解决合并冲突:
如果两个分支在同一文件的同一行有不同的修改,会导致合并冲突。在这种情况下,需要手动解决冲突,编辑文件以解决冲突,并在解决冲突后重新提交修改。
8. 查看分支:
通过以下命令,可以查看当前仓库中所有的分支:
“`shell
$ git branch
“`当前分支名称前面会显示一个`*`。
9. 切换到特定的提交版本:
如果需要回退到某个特定的提交版本,可以使用以下命令:
“`shell
$ git checkout
“`其中,`
`是要切换到的提交版本的哈希值。 10. 标签管理:
为特定的提交版本打上标签可以方便进行版本管理。要创建一个新的标签,可以使用以下命令:
“`shell
$ git tag
“`其中,`
`是标签的名称,` `是要被打标签的提交版本的哈希值。 以上就是使用Git进行多版本管理的方法和操作流程。通过合理地使用分支、提交和合并等操作,可以有效地管理项目的版本。
2年前